Acne Acne is a skin condition that causes whiteheads, blackheads, and red, inflamed patches of skin (such as cysts). It occurs when tiny holes on the surface of the skin become clogged with sebum, dead skin cells, and bacteria. Acne can affect men and women of any age group. However, it is more common in teenagers and adults. There are many reasons for acne including hormonal changes, stress, and dietary issues. Among the most important things to do to prevent acne is to wash your face regularly. Always use a gentle cleanser that will help get rid of the excess oil, bacteria, and dirt.
